The Enterprise Europe Network (EEN) Supports Ireland’s Largest Business Networking Event

Katherine Fitzpatrick, Manager of the EEN in Cork says, “Our network is dedicated to assisting companies to find suitable business partners, and this is the whole idea behind CORKMEET 2010. With pre-arranged, one-to-one meetings, CORKMEET presents a fantastic opportunity for Irish businesses to unlock opportunities with potential clients and suppliers throughout the country and internationally. It is a must attend event for businesses this year”.

Katherine went on to say, “The Enterprise Europe Network has a strong network worldwide and an in-depth knowledge of the European markets. We have a significant role in educating and assisting local businesses to generate new trading alliances between Ireland and the rest of Europe, as well as answering many types of business enquiries. Staff from the Enterprise Europe Network centres country-wide will be on hand at CORKMEET 2010 to answer queries on European projects, funding opportunities and doing business abroad. Companies who sign up to CORKMEET will also have the opportunity to arrange a one-to-one meeting with EEN experts in technology transfer, licensing and innovation, in order to gain specialised advice in these areas”.

CORKMEET offers companies three days of activities, including networking, pre-arranged meetings, a gala dinner and a half-day conference, each providing an opportunity to make vital contacts all under one roof. This year CORKMEET plays host to an International Village, with representatives from numerous different Embassies present to advise Irish SMEs about doing business in their markets.

Furthermore, companies who sign up are also being offered the opportunity to meet with some large organisations in the Cork region, including Bord Gáis, Brittany Ferries, Carbery Milk Products, Cascade Designs, Centocor, Cognis, Eircom, EMC, ESB, Heineken Ireland, Janssen Pharmaceutical, Musgrave Super Value Centra Distribution, Premier Conferencing, Project Management, AIB, Bank of Ireland, Stryker Orthopaedic, Ulster Bank and Cork County Council.
